    Discovery of oil-bearing dolomite in Dazhuoma area of Qiangtang Basin and its significance

    • The dolomite serves as the most important reservoir which has always been the key to the evaluation and exploration of oil and gas. The oil-bearing dolomite was found recently near the Dazhuoma area, Amdo. The oil-bearing dolomite develops in the Buqu Formation of Middle Jurassic with the thickness over 30m and the length over 80m. The rocks are the medium-coarse-grain dolomite. The porosity of the samples is in the range of 5%~17% and the permeability is from 2.84×10-3μm2 to 236×10-3μm2. The dolomite belongs to the low-porosity and low-permeability to medium-porosity and low-permeability reservoir which is similar to the high quality dolomite of Longeni. The new oil-bearing dolomite found in Amdo lies in the same layer as the dolomite in the Bi-luo Co-Angdaer Co zone, from which the authors infer that the oil-bearing dolomite has an east-west distribution for about 180km and is the most important reservoir in the basin. The discovery of oil-bearing dolomite in Dazhuoma area expands the distribution and extent of dolomite reservoir, which can provide new basis for the oil exploration and disposition in Qiangtang Basin.
